If you wish to get an Iran visa extension while you are in Iran, you will be glad to know that there is an easy way to do that.
An Iran visa extension can be done twice, each for the same number of days as your first visa. You can also extend your visa If you are visiting Iran visa-free.
How to extend your visa?
To apply for an extension, you should go to the Police Department of Alien Affairs. The process is usually done within one day. These offices are mostly crowded, and almost no one speaks English. It’s better to be accompanied by an Iranian to help you through the process.
An Iran visa extension should be done between 4 and 1 day(s) before it expires.
Extending an Iran visa: a step-by-step guide
You need to go to an immigration and passport office to extend your visa. It’s a simple process and described below:
- First is the security check. You have to leave your phone or any other electronic device at the entrance in a safe box. You are not allowed to carry a bag either.
- Go to the visa extension counter, where you should fill out two forms.
- Head to the Tourism Affairs counter, where you will be asked a few questions regarding your request. The questions are about where you want to travel (name cities and hotels) and the expected duration of your extension.
- Afterwards, you need to go to the payment counter to pay the extension fee. You need to use an Iranian debit card. If you don’t have one, you will be directed to the nearest Melli Bank.
- Once all the documents have been prepared, return them to the Passport Collection Counter.
- Wait for the process to be finished to get your passport with an extension stamp.
List of requirement documents for a visa extension
Besides your passport, you need to have the following documents:
- 2 copies of your current Iran visa
- 2 passport-sized photos (women should wear a headscarf)
- 2 copies of your passport (photo page)
- 2 copies of the completed visa extension form
- 2 copies of your payment receipt
Although there are copy machines in there, it’s better to have them beforehand. Sometimes, it’s also possible to have your identity photo taken there.
Time and Fees
It usually takes a few hours, and you can collect your visa the same morning. It is recommended to be at the Immigration and Passport Office early in the morning (8 AM).
The extension fee is about 5,000,000 rials, which is about 10 euros.
Where to apply for a visa extension?
You can get your visa extension through a police department of alien affairs. These departments can be found in most Iranian cities. You can search for the nearest one on Google Maps.
Each immigration office differs from the others. Unlike Isfahan, immigration offices of Shiraz and Yazd are known to be quicker to get your extension.
Immigration offices are open from Saturday to Wednesday between 7:30 AM and 2 PM. The sooner you get there, the easier and quicker you can get your extension.
